Tiger OS-X and the Lone Coders

Om Malik | Tuesday, April 12, 2005 | 10:51 AM PT | 1 comment

Finally Apple has announced that Mac OS X 10.4 aka Tiger will ship on April 29th. Fantastic news! But I wonder if this news has caught the lone coders or small developers by surprise. Many were not sure about the release date and are now scrambling to get their act together, and making sure that their programs work well with OS-X 10.4 aka Tiger. I pinged a few folks like Near-Time and Ranchero Software, and they indicated that all will be fine and dandy by the time Tiger rolls around. Another company, EZ2Sync, which makes software to synchronize Entourage with iCal and AddressBook and iSync sent an email saying that they were trying to upgrade their software to work well on Tiger.
